Hub

What is a Hub in logistics?

A hub is the "main transhipment base" in the logistics chain. It is a place where consignments are collected, sorted and reloaded. Generally, the hub is regarded as the central location for dealing with all the activities that are related to the movement of goods, organisation and coordination within a national and international borders.
